“…The most well-known MIMs are rotaxanes 26 , 27 and catenanes 28 30 . Such sophisticated topological structure allows for abundant dynamic behaviors, which thus bestow unique features upon the resultant mechanically interlocked materials: i) The existence of supramolecular templates allows mechanical bonds to respond to various stimuli such as acid/base, force, and heat, which induces intramolecular movements to modulate the material’s properties 31 37 . ii) The motion of mechanical bonds facilitates the dissipation of energy without requiring the separation of their components, which preserves the structural integrity and represents a unique mechanism for energy dissipation 38 40 .…”
